Step 3:
Plug in, then turn on your modem.
Wait approximately 2 minutes
until your modem turns on.
If your modem has a battery backup,
first remove and reinsert the battery
before connecting your
modem to power.

Connect the power adapter to the
router, then plug it into an outlet.
Wait for the 2.4 GHz LED (
)
to turn on.
If none of the LEDs turn on, make sure the
Power On/Off button is in the ON position
(pushed in).
